NOTE 11 – STOCK-BASED COMPENSATION
Stock Options and Restricted Stock
On May 21, 2026, the shareholders of FS Bancorp approved the FS Bancorp, Inc. 2026 Equity Incentive Plan (the “2026 Plan”) which authorized the issuance of up to 315,000 shares of the Company's common stock. The 2026 Plan provides for the grant of incentive stock options, nonqualified stock options, restricted stock awards (“RSAs”), and restricted stock units to directors, officers, employees, and other eligible service providers of the Company. At June 30, 2026, no awards had been granted under the 2026 Plan and 315,000 shares remained available for future grants.
On May 17, 2018, the shareholders of FS Bancorp approved the FS Bancorp 2018 Equity Incentive Plan (the “2018 Plan”) which authorized 1.3 million shares of the Company’s common stock to be awarded. The 2018 Plan provides for the grant of incentive stock options, nonqualified stock options, and up to 326,000 shares as RSAs to directors, emeritus directors, officers, employees and advisory directors of the Company. At June 30, 2026, there were 52,060 stock option awards and 500 RSAs available for future grants under the 2018 Plan.
Total share-based compensation expense was $643,000 and $1.3 million for the three and six months ended June 30, 2026, and $526,000 and $1.0 million for the three and six months ended June 30, 2025, respectively.
Stock-based compensation awards are settled by issuing new shares from the Company's pool of authorized but unissued common stock, rather than previously repurchased treasury shares.
Stock Options
The 2026 Plan and 2018 Plan provide for the grant of stock option awards that may be designated as either incentive stock options or nonqualified stock options. Stock option awards generally vest over a -year period for non-employee directors and over a - or -year period for employees and officers, with annual vesting in equal installments on the anniversary date of each grant date, provided the award recipient remains in continuous service with the Company. Options become exercisable after vesting and remain exercisable for the remaining term of the original grant, subject to a maximum term of 10 years. Any unexercised stock options expire 10 years after the grant date, or earlier upon the termination of the recipient's service with the Company or the Bank.
The fair value of each stock option award is estimated on the grant date using a Black-Scholes option pricing model, which incorporates the following assumptions. The dividend yield is based on the current quarterly dividend in effect at the time of the grant. The historical volatility of the Company's stock price over a specified period of time is used for the expected volatility. The Company bases the risk-free interest rate on the comparable U.S. Treasury rate in effect on the grant date for the expected term of the option. The Company elected to use the simplified expected term calculation method permitted by Staff Accounting Bulletin No. 107 for “Share-Based Payments” to calculate the expected term. This method uses the vesting term of an option along with the contractual term, setting the expected life at 5.5 years for -year vesting, 6.25 years for -year vesting, and 6.5 years for -year vesting.

At June 30, 2026, there was $2.2 million of total unrecognized compensation cost related to nonvested stock options granted under the 2018 Plan. The cost is expected to be recognized over the remaining weighted-average vesting period of 2.8 years.
Restricted Stock Awards
The fair value of RSAs is equal to the market price of FS Bancorp’s common stock on the grant date. Compensation expense is recognized over the vesting period of the awards based on the fair value of the restricted stock. Shares granted under the 2026 Plan and the 2018 Plan generally vest over a - or -year period for employees and officers, beginning on the grant date, and over a -year period for non-employee directors, with vesting occurring at the end of the one-year period. Any nonvested RSAs are forfeited upon the award recipient’s termination of service with the Company or the Bank.

At June 30, 2026, there was $2.6 million of total unrecognized compensation cost related to nonvested shares granted under the 2018 Plan as RSAs. The cost is expected to be recognized over the remaining weighted-average vesting period of 2.8 years.
